Pagid RSL Compound

RSL 19

Pagid RSL 19 Best Practice::
Pagid RSL 19 is one of the cornerstone friction compounds for Pagid Racing and has decades of victories in the worlds legendary Endurance event as Pagid RS19 or known as Pagid “Yellow”. It has found current favor as a rear axle usage compound in GT4, GT3 and GTE / GTLM, in combination with RSL 1 and RSL 2 on the front axle. It remains a favorite pad for front axle usage for lighter GT and Touring cars.

Pagid RSL 19 Compound Description::
RSL 19 is a low metallic resin bonded material containing steel and aramid fibers. It maintains a constant friction level across a broad range of temperatures. The material features very good modulation and release characteristic.

Pagid RST Compound

RST 3

Pagid RST 3 Best Practice::
Pagid RST3 is intended as a medium-high friction compound for use in Tarmac and Gravel Rally, GT, Touring, and Prototype circuit racing cars. It also excels on Formula cars and in club racing and a wide range of applications due to its combination of bite, friction and controllability. The release characteristic of RST 3 makes it ideal for use with ABS systems.

Pagid RST 3 Compound Description::
RST 3 is a metal-ceramic compound containing steel fibers and is therefore the perfect complement of the RST product family. It captivates by its low heat conductivity.

Pagid RST Compound

RST 4

Pagid RST 4 Best Practice::
RST 4 is intended as a medium friction pad compound for use in Formula cars and open wheel racing. RST 4 works well as a rear axle material for Rally (tarmac and gravel) and for all front engine cars. Also used in NASCAR on long ovals.

Pagid RST 4 Compound Description::
RST 4 is a semi metallic resin bonded material containing steel fibers. This material has a medium friction level and high temperature resistance.

Pagid RS Compound

RS 14

Pagid RS 14 Best Practice::
RS 14, aka PAGID “Black”, is another of the cornerstone Pagid Racing pad compounds, and has seen years of success in GT cars, Touring cars for club racing and track days. Indeed, it remains a favorite in all of those venues to this day. RS 14 is an excellent all-around pad compound.

Pagid RS 14 Compound Description::
RS 14 features good all-around characteristics for many applications. It is a low metallic resin bonded material containing steel and aramid fibers.

Pagid RS Compound

RS 29

Pagid RS 29 Best Practice::
RS 29 is a legend in Endurance Racing, and has an unmatched history of success since its introduction as RS29. It remains very popular in club racing and track days. In addition, it is still found on GT, Touring cars, and Prototypes, and still enjoys a reputation as a great all-around friction material for endurance racing. Due to excellent modulation characteristics also often used in sprint races.

Pagid RS 29 Compound Description::
RS 29 features very good modulation and release characteristics. It is a low metallic resin bonded material containing steel and aramid fibers. The friction level of the material maintains constant at a low-medium level. Another advantage is the easy bedding in behavior.

Pagid RS Compound

RS 42

Pagid RS 42 Best Practice::
RS 42, or Pagid “Blue”, is another of the “cornerstone” Pagid Racing compounds that is still finding favor after many years of service. It is currently best used as a classic rally pad and remains very popular in small formula and touring cars, especially as a rear axle compound.

Pagid RS 42 Compound Description::
RS 42 is a low metallic resin bonded material containing steel and aramid fibers. The characteristics make this material appropriate for small formula cars.

Pagid RS Compound

RS 44

Pagid RS 44 Best Practice::
RS 44 is a close relative of RS 42, and has a similar history of success. Known as RS4-4 or Pagid “Orange” in the past, it is a good rear axle pad for all front engine cars. Very popular club racing compound.

Pagid RS 44 Compound Description::
RS 44 works for formula cars all the way up to lighter passenger cars. It is a low metallic resin bonded material containing steel and aramid fibers. The smooth progression of friction from cold to hot makes this material easy to work with.
